1. Waffle Wonderland: Where to Get Your Sweet Fix πŸͺ

Brussels is synonymous with waffles, and for good reason. Whether you prefer the crispy Liege or the fluffy Brussels style, you’re in for a treat.
🌟 Tip: Head to Waffle Corner on Rue des Bouchers for a legendary experience. Their Liege waffles are so good, you might just eat two. 🀀
But don’t stop there! Try the vegan options at The Vegan Waffle for a guilt-free indulgence. πŸ“πŸŒ±

2. Comic Book City: Tracing the Steps of Tintin and Co. πŸ“šπŸŽ¨

Brussels is the birthplace of some of the world’s most beloved comic book characters. Start your adventure at the Belgian Comic Strip Center, where you can dive deep into the history of Tintin, Smurfs, and more.
:Fun Fact: Keep an eye out for the colorful murals scattered throughout the city. Each one tells a story from a famous comic. πŸŽ¨πŸšΆβ€β™‚οΈ
For a truly immersive experience, visit the Tintin Museum in Ixelles. It’s a must-visit for any fan of Hergé’s adventures. πŸ•΅οΈβ€β™‚οΈ

3. Historical Highlights: Beyond the Grand Place πŸ›οΈ

The Grand Place is a UNESCO World Heritage site and a true gem of Brussels. But there’s so much more to explore.
:Must-Visit: The Atomium is a futuristic landmark that offers breathtaking views of the city. Climb to the top for a panoramic experience. πŸŒ†πŸš€
Don’t miss the Manneken Pis, the iconic little peeing boy statue. He’s been around since 1388 and has over 500 costumes! πŸ§‘β€πŸ€β€πŸ§‘πŸ‘—
For art lovers, the Royal Museums of Fine Arts of Belgium houses works by Rubens, Magritte, and other masters. πŸŽ¨πŸ–ΌοΈ

4. Foodie Frenzy: Beyond Waffles and Chocolate 🍫🍷

While waffles and chocolate are must-tries, Brussels has a rich culinary scene that goes beyond the classics.
:Local Favorite: Try moules-frites (mussels and fries) at a traditional Belgian restaurant. Pair it with a local beer for the ultimate taste of Belgium. 🍀🍺
For a unique experience, visit the Brussels Beer Project for craft beers that will blow your mind. πŸΊπŸŽ‰
:Tip: Don’t leave without trying speculoos cookies. They’re crunchy, spiced, and perfect with coffee. β˜•πŸͺ

5. Hidden Gems: Off the Beaten Path 🌱;

Brussels has plenty of hidden gems waiting to be discovered.
:Secret Spot: Explore the Jardin botanique de Bruxelles (Botanical Garden) for a peaceful retreat in the heart of the city. 🌸🌿
:Quirky Find: Visit the House of European History for a fascinating look at the continent’s past and present. πŸ›οΈπŸ“œ
:Chill Out: Spend an afternoon at the Cinquantenaire Park and enjoy the beautiful fountains and green spaces. 🌳🌞
